Driveway sealing is a service that involves applying a protective coating to the surface of a driveway, typically made of asphalt or concrete. This process helps create a barrier against moisture, chemicals, and other elements that can cause deterioration over time. Proper sealing not only enhances the appearance of a driveway by providing a smooth, uniform finish but also helps extend its lifespan by preventing cracks, potholes, and surface erosion. Service providers use specialized sealants that penetrate the surface and form a durable layer, offering long-lasting protection for the driveway.

Sealing a driveway can address common problems such as cracking, surface wear, and staining. Over time, exposure to sunlight, rain, snow, and vehicle traffic can weaken the driveway surface, leading to unsightly cracks and surface deterioration. Sealing helps fill small cracks and prevents water from seeping in, which can cause further damage. It also makes the surface more resistant to oil, gasoline, and other stains, making maintenance easier. Homeowners often consider driveway sealing when they notice the surface looking faded, cracked, or stained, as it can restore a fresh appearance and help avoid costly repairs.

The overview below groups typical Driveway Sealing proj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Most routine driveway sealing projects for minor cracks or surface touch-ups typically cost between $250 and $600. These jobs are common and usually fall within the middle of the pricing range. Fewer projects will reach into the higher end of this spectrum.

Standard Sealing - A standard driveway sealing service for an average-sized driveway generally ranges from $600 to $1,200. Many local contractors handle these projects regularly within this price band. Larger or more complex jobs may cost more but are less common.

Large or Multiple Driveways - For extensive driveways or multiple surface areas, costs can range from $1,200 to $3,000. These larger projects are less frequent and typically involve more surface area or additional preparation work.

Full Replacement or Major Repairs - Complete driveway replacement or major structural repairs can exceed $5,000, depending on size and complexity. Such projects are less typical and usually involve significant work beyond sealing services.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is driveway sealing? Driveway sealing involves applying a protective coating to asphalt surfaces to help prevent damage from weather, water, and everyday wear.

Why should I consider driveway sealing? Sealing can extend the lifespan of a driveway by protecting it from cracks, fading, and deterioration caused by exposure to the elements.

What types of driveway sealing services are available? Local contractors typically offer asphalt sealing, crack filling, and surface rejuvenation to maintain and protect driveways.

How often should driveway sealing be performed? Generally, driveway sealing is recommended every 2 to 3 years to maintain optimal protection and appearance.
